Output 7023caa0ceb4140c8eb38ed02659ffbaa2e7d2acca042e76d43134b78ff1cd84:1

value
1799205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ae3a69ad782de5bbef3915c3cfa20a5b1e114a86 OP_EQUAL
address
3HaFUWpbJVd4AJc9qVkYaGxp3Tb2RUcdxV
transaction
7023caa0ceb4140c8eb38ed02659ffbaa2e7d2acca042e76d43134b78ff1cd84
confirmations
323135
spent
true